WebApr 6, 2024 · Horse Drawn Equipment Auction Date: April 14, 2024 Financial Calculator Item Location: New Paris, Indiana 46553 Condition: Used Stock Number: 36549 Compare Polk … WebDec 1, 2007 · Horse-drawn planters of that era used a sled-style marker to create a grid on the field. The grid ensured uniform rows, which made cross-cultivation easier, keeping the field weed-free. Two people (often a farmer and his son) operated the planter.
